Jōmon dwelling internet sites have been present in various elements of the state. They are often classified into two forms: just one, the pit-type dwelling, consisted of a shallow pit which has a flooring of trodden earth and a roof; the opposite was produced by laying a circular or oval ground of clay or stones about the floor of the bottom and covering it having a roof. Remains of such dwellings are already located in groups ranging from 5 or 6 to several dozen, evidently symbolizing the size of human settlements at enough time.
